Top Cardano Wallets Summary
| Wallet | Type | Key Features | Price |
|---|---|---|---|
| Ledger Nano X | Hardware | Offline security, staking, native tokens | $149 |
| VESPR | Mobile | ADA staking, NFT support | Free |
| Yoroi | Browser/Mobile | Lightweight, EMURGO-backed | Free |
| Lace | Browser | dApp integration, governance | Free |
| Eternl | Browser/Mobile | Advanced token management | Free |
| NuFi | Multi-chain | Supports multiple blockchains | Free |
| Daedalus | Desktop | Full-node, maximum security | Free |
| Exodus | Multi-platform | Simple ADA staking | Free |

Types of Cardano Wallets
Hot Wallets
- Pros: Easy access, staking support.
- Cons: Less secure than hardware wallets.
Cold Wallets (Hardware)
- Pros: Maximum security.
- Cons: Less convenient for frequent transactions.
